Corinne Lepage has a doctorate in law and, because of her experience, is developing a consulting practice, including strategic consulting, and litigation. She works with both large companies and start-ups, French and foreign public authorities and associations. Corinne Lepage follows major environmental, energy and environmental health cases and manages major pollution cases and natural and industrial disasters. She is one of the EU’s specialists in these areas.
Co-founder, with Christian Huglo, of the law firm Huglo Lepage Avocats in 1978, she has held numerous public positions: member of the Conseil de l’ordre and Secretary of the Conseil (1987-1990), Minister of the Environment (1995-1997), Deputy and then First Deputy Mayor of Cabourg (1989-2001), MEP (2009-2014). She lectures in very large companies on the evolution of climate and environmental issues linked to economic issues.
